Subject: [PATCH] dt-bindings: mfd: Add link to ROHM BD71847 Datasheet
Date: Thu, 13 Jun 2019 15:12:38 +0300 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190613121237.GA8984@localhost.localdomain> (raw)
ROHM BD71847 PMIC datasheet was published.
Add datasheet link for BD71847 as well.
Signed-off-by: Matti Vaittinen <matti.vaittinen@fi.rohmeurope.com>
---
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/rohm,bd71837-pmic.txt | 2 ++
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)
di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/rohm,bd71837-pmic.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/rohm,bd71837-pmic.txt
index d5f68ac78d15..3c421bdbffc5 100644
---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/rohm,bd71837-pmic.txt
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/rohm,bd71837-pmic.txt
@@ -8,6 +8,8 @@ and 6 LDOs.
Datasheet for BD71837 is available at:
https://www.rohm.com/datasheet/BD71837MWV/bd71837mwv-e
+Datasheet for BD71847 is available at:
+https://www.rohm.com/datasheet/BD71847AMWV/bd71847amwv-e
Required properties:
- compatible : Should be "rohm,bd71837" for bd71837
